diff options
author | Joseph Eagar <joeedh@gmail.com> | 2009-06-18 11:11:55 +0400 |
---|---|---|
committer | Joseph Eagar <joeedh@gmail.com> | 2009-06-18 11:11:55 +0400 |
commit | 5abbb20c899206355e714e12aaf5400260b83814 (patch) | |
tree | 530e351d15e14e2804916b03a34a699793ce4c9f /source/blender/blenkernel/BKE_tessmesh.h | |
parent | 9dfb7c4cf048b09807fbc48859a7c8c9c6697085 (diff) |
extrude handles active face, and operators now properly restore unmodified mesh on failure
Diffstat (limited to 'source/blender/blenkernel/BKE_tessmesh.h')
-rw-r--r-- | source/blender/blenkernel/BKE_tessmesh.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/source/blender/blenkernel/BKE_tessmesh.h b/source/blender/blenkernel/BKE_tessmesh.h index bf940b8c71b..c3ccf4b1e6a 100644 --- a/source/blender/blenkernel/BKE_tessmesh.h +++ b/source/blender/blenkernel/BKE_tessmesh.h @@ -28,6 +28,9 @@ typedef struct BMEditSelection and not BMesh. Mesh->editbmesh will store a pointer to this structure.*/ typedef struct BMEditMesh { struct BMesh *bm; + + /*this is for undoing failed operations*/ + struct BMEditMesh *emcopy; /*we store tesselations as triplets of three loops, which each define a triangle.*/ |